Output 23e52acb3d5837156638165d68e0f777c274e5096ace2c5ae05a7182189e0be0:0

value
8360913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c60bab20a888e71869ffbe360c2445b5cc2679 OP_EQUAL
address
3DRufYdbngea9a5jxzm1gVfk9VBsxe15QE
transaction
23e52acb3d5837156638165d68e0f777c274e5096ace2c5ae05a7182189e0be0
spent
true